UV/visible spectroscopy will involve measuring the absorption of ultraviolet or visible light by molecules. It makes use of light during the wavelength variety of 200-800 nm. The true secret components of the UV-visible spectrophotometer are a light-weight resource, wavelength selector for instance a monochromator, sample holder, detector, and related electronics.
